Indigenous environmental activist murdered in northern Mexico

José Trinidad Baldenegro, an indigenous activist who fought against illegal logging, was shot to death and his house was set on fire by unknown assailants, confirmed this Saturday the prosecutor’s office of the northern state of chihuahua.

The agency informed journalists that the crime occurred last Monday in an isolated area in the south of the state, in the mountains inhabited by the Tarahumara Indians, also called Raramuri.

“The southern district prosecutor’s office initiated the corresponding investigations to clarify the intentional homicide committed to the detriment of who was identified as José Trinidad B.”says a statement that by law reserves the surnames of the victims.

The 47-year-old activist was attacked by armed men when he went out to work in the bush. The aggressors then went to his house, threatened people who were in the area and set it on fire, according to the first investigations revealed by the prosecution.

The Tarahumara ethnic activist was the brother of another environmental defender from the same area, Isidro Baldenegro, who was also murdered on January 15, 2917.

The brothers denounced the illegal felling of forests at the hands of local bosses in collusion with alleged criminals.

The community is located in the area known as the Golden Triangle, where the majority of the population is Tarahumara, who have been fighting for legal ownership of their land for decades.

chihuahuabordering the United States, has been one of the states hardest hit by the wave of criminal violence that has hit Mexico for fifteen years.

Last Thursday, the European Parliament approved a resolution calling on the Mexican government to protect journalists and human rights defenders.

In the resolution, the main representative body of the European Union warns that since the July 2018 elections, when leftist President Andrés Manuel López Obrador was elected, 47 journalists and 68 activists have been killed.

López Obrador rejected the call and accused the European deputies of “sheep” who join the “coup strategy” of their opponents.
